Is the speed of light equal to 1?

When physicists work out equations in relativity they often set the speed of light to one: c = 1. This makes the equations more tidy. It amounts to defining natural units of measurement in which the speed of light is exactly one unit.

What is speed of light in air?

The speed of light is 3×108 ms−1 in vacuum or air, 2.25×108 ms−1 in water and 2×108 ms−1 in glass.

What is the SI unit of speed of light *?

In SI units, the speed of light in vacuum is defined to be exactly 299,792,458 metres per second (1,079,252,849 km/h).

Why is the speed of light called c?

Speed of light is now universally represented by symbol ‘c’. This symbol originated from the initial letter of the Latin word “celerity” meaning “swift” or “quick”. This symbol was used by Weber and Kohlrausch in their papers in 1856.

Who discovered light speed?

Part of the Cosmic Horizons Curriculum Collection. In 1676, the Danish astronomer Ole Roemer (1644–1710) became the first person to measure the speed of light. Roemer measured the speed of light by timing eclipses of Jupiter’s moon Io.

How is the speed of light 1 measured?

We just cannot measure the speed of light in one direction because relativity prevents us from maintaining synchronised clocks. The result is that the speed of light c is really the average speed over a round-trip journey, and that we cannot be certain that the speed is the same in both directions.
